How to Force Shutdown or Force Soft Reset or Reboot or Restart XIAOMI 13T ?

We can install more multitasking apps because it has big RAM 8 GB or 12 GB. However, when some installed applications crash or corrupt or stuck, then the LCD touch screen may not responsive with our finger touch or hang. We need to clean temporary files and caches.

When it stuck or freezing, please try to press and hold POWER BUTTON until XIAOMI 13T turning off or shutdown by itself. We also can try to press POWER BUTTON + VOLUME DOWN together to force turn it off.

When our phone still work properly, but we want to clean temporary files and caches, please press and hold POWER BUTTON until pop-up menu appear and choose Shutdown / Power off / Reboot. Soft reset or restart process will not remove any installed apps and important data, therefore we can do this process anytime we want.

#Option 2, Hard Reset XIAOMI 13T with Hardware Button Key to Recovery Mode

  1. Turn Off XIAOMI 13T
  2. Make sure the battery is fully charge
  3. Press and holdPOWER BUTTON + VOLUME UP BUTTONkey
  4. Release all button after the LCD show Recovery Mode
  5. UseVolume Buttonto select the option and pressPOWER Buttonto Ok or Confirm or Choose. Please choose Wipe all data to finish the Hard Reset or Master Format Steps
  6. Wait until the XIAOMI 13T finish the process and the phone will start again like new
